Environmental Stewardship Committee – Tree Subcommittee meeting on Dec. 14

0Comments

Wednesday, December 14, 2022

The purpose is to review Chapter 23. The public is invited to attend.

Please Note: Two or more members of the City Commission or any board or committee of the City of Atlantic Beach may be in attendance. 

In accordance with the Americans with Disabilities Act, persons needing a special accommodation to participate in this proceeding should contact Donna Bartle, City Clerk, at 247-5809 or at City Hall, 800 Seminole Road,  by Noon on the Friday prior to the meeting.

Date: December 14, 2022

Time: 5:15 PM

Location: City Hall, Commission Chamber

Address: 800 Seminole Road Atlantic Beach, FL 32233

Contact: (904) 247-5841
